Structural materials to ensure electromagnetic compatibility of radio equipment

The article discusses the main structural materials used for electromagnetic shielding, such as gaskets, contact springs, fabrics, heat shrink tubes, RF radiation absorbers. A technique for confirming the characteristics of shielding materials in TESTPRIBOR JSC EMC laboratory is described.
